Also, I > BE> couldn't get AVG to run in safe mode both times I tried it???? > > BE> Anyway, it's gone now but I wish I knew what I did. > > There are two ways to get access to files in "\System Volume > Information". The first way is to turn off System Restore, as has been > mentioned. The other way is to add your UserId to the Security tab of > the Properties sheet for the folder. Normally, only the System account > has access to the folder, but anyone with Administrator privileges can > add other users. The second method has the advantage that you don't > lose your Restore Points (i.e., your backups). > > I don't know why the AV manufacturers don't add the extra code needed > to remove viruses, etc., from "\System Volume Information".
